I could have even done another 20 odd ks into Leigh Creek, the wind was vigorous and of enormous assistance as I sped across the asphalt but I was apprehended by the local constabulary and issued a blue Expiation Notice for “failure to wear a bicycle helmet” and although being in South Australia where people are renown as either serial killers, or polite and civil, I was lucky enough in that this particular bloke in blue was in the latter category and in the Total Amount Due column of the form was written, CAUTION ONLY, in an almost illegible primary school scrawl.

Despite that ultimate joy in our encounter, he was mostly interested in my travels, the helmet was an issue but just one of compliance with the law, acknowledging out here not so much of safety, it kind of knocked the wind from my sails and when I spotted a terrific campsite adjacent to an abandoned stone cottage, roof and floorless, just the stonework upstanding, I ceased the whirring of pedals for the day and even finished a little early satisfied that I’ve had my fastest day since I left Alice Springs and probably Perth, the wind and road surface, a good proportion in smooth clay graded yesterday and this morning, the grader waving as I sped on by.

Tomorrow I reacquaint myself with all that has happened unbeknownst to me for the previous 11 days since I left that last communication point for the internet back in Birdsville.

And hopefully Pete’s Brooks saddle will be awaiting, just as my posterior has finally and painfully moulded itself to my Mt Isa replacement seat.
